Preheat the oven to 400°. Coat 12 muffin cups with
non-stick cooking spray or grease them according to your preferred method.
Combine the soymilk, eggs, oil, honey and salt in a large bowl. Mix well.
Add the cornmeal, rice and baking powder. Mix again, until the rice
is broken up and everything is well blended.
Divide the batter evenly between the prepared muffin cups. They may
be filled more than half full because these muffins only rise a
little bit.
Bake the muffins at 400° for 20 minutes. Remove from the oven
and then from the pan. Makes 12 muffins.
Notes
These are tender, moist muffins, but they don't rise especially high.
They are hearty though and perfect for accompanying spicy main dishes.
When you have leftover rice, these muffins are a great way to use it
up. Be sure to crumble the rice with your hands or a fork so it
doesn't clump together in the muffins.
